נָגַשׂ

nâgas · naw-gas'Hebrew · H5065

Derivation

a primitive root;

Meaning

to drive (an animal, a workman, a debtor, an army); by implication, to tax, harass, tyrannize

In the King James Version

distress, driver, exact(-or), oppress(-or), [idiom] raiser of taxes, taskmaster.

Translated as

taskmasters (5), oppressor (4), exact (3), distressed (2), oppressed (2), exacted (1), oppressors (1), exactors (1), taxes (1)
